Leeston
A very fine memorial window was unveiled at the Leeston church at Christmas (writes our travelling correspondent). It was erected to the memory of one of the oldest parishioners, Mr. Joseph Campbell, and is placed in the north transept as a centre figure. It represents the subject of the Sacred Heart, and is a very tasteful arid artistic example of the work of Messrs. Bradley Brothers, Christchurch, the well-known firm of experts in this line.
